Output 77f730de08166abefc8f26b953c37c560b67b3975a2f3b23c16f6095ed57d2f1:12

value
5908692
script pubkey
OP_0 OP_PUSHBYTES_20 7a003c5c7c214f754c059849d4fe58011ac7bcc4
address
bc1q0gqrchruy98h2nq9npyafljcqydv00xyuwe76g
transaction
77f730de08166abefc8f26b953c37c560b67b3975a2f3b23c16f6095ed57d2f1
spent
true